The UK Preconception Early and Mid-career Researchers (EMCR) Network was established in October 2021 with the aim of bringing together EMCRs, Clinicians, Policy Makers and Mentors who have an interest in preconception health and care. The Network is part of the wider Health in Preconception, Pregnancy and Postpartum EMCR Collectives (HiPPP EMR-C), which creates opportunities to form national and international multi-disciplinary collaborations, as well as supporting career development and building capacity and impact in the pre- and interconception health and care field.
This 1-day hybrid conference will be held on 16th October 2023, from 11am – 4:30pm at The University of Birmingham and on Zoom.
 
The conference will include a keynote speaker, EMCR presentations, a quick-fire panel session, an interactive workshop and networking opportunities. For more information on the programme, visit their website.
 
In-person registration is £40 early bird and £20 student early bird, this includes catering (tea/coffee, lunch and afternoon tea). Online registration is £20 early bird and £10 student early bird. Early bird tickets will be available until 13th August. In-person ticket sale will close on 15th September.
